What's the best way to centralize WhatsApp communication for my sales and support team?
Short answer
Move off staff personal numbers onto one WhatsApp Business API number with a shared inbox. The scattered-personal-numbers pattern loses history when someone leaves, gives you no reporting, and means customers reach an individual rather than your business. Consolidating gives one identity, assignment, roles and a conversation record you own. Migration takes days, not weeks.

Related questions
Can I keep my existing business number?
Usually yes. An existing number can be migrated to the WhatsApp Business API, though it must be removed from the WhatsApp Business app first and cannot be used in both places at once.
What happens to chats already on staff phones?
Those stay on the personal devices — the API cannot retroactively import them. Migrate the contact list and tags, and treat the cut-over date as the start of your shared history.
How long does consolidation take?
Meta verification is the long pole and is typically measured in days. The inbox, roles and contact import are same-day work.
